Hi,

I am trying to open a library (rdutils.pll) in forms builder, but it stops working. I am not sure what is causing the form developer to hung.

However, i am able to open many library files, all other .pll files but this particular is causing issue. i have attached the screen-shot, if it is helpful..

I have set environment variables as below:

forms_path : C:\myforms

Below are the other related details,

Oracle forms & reports suit 10g
Operating system is Win 7 (64 bit)
PLL file causing issue : rdutils.pll

Can you open this PL/SQL Library on a different computer? Do you have a backup copy of the library, hopefully, in a source management tool? What is your exact version of Oracle Forms 10g (eg: 10.1.x.x.x)? There is only one version of Forms 10g certified for Windows 7 32-bit. The only edition of Oracle Forms certified for 64-bit Windows is Forms 11g and Forms 12c.

Quote:
i tried to open this library on another computer without any success.

This is not good. Some of the possible causes are:
1. This library has an attached library. Try putting all of your .pll files in the same directory as the rdutil.pll and then try opening again.
2. The library was last edited with a newer version of Forms 10g R2. Version 10.1.2.0.2 is the initial release of Forms 10g R2. Check with the other developers to see is everyone is using the same version. The most current version of Forms 10g R2 is 10.1.3.x.x. My guess is that the last person to edit this library was using a newer version.
3. The library is corrupt. Checkout an earlier version of the library from your source control and see if the problem persists. Go back as far as you need to find a version you can open. Unfortunately, if the file is corrupt, you will have to apply all of the changes to the library bring it up to date.

Quote:
I don't have admin access on my machine, could this be the issue..not sure.

Oracle Forms has to be installed as an Administrator, but you don't have to have Administrator rights to use it once it is installed - so long as it was installed correctly. I don't believe this would be the problem, though, because you would have problems using Forms Builder in general - not with just one file.
